David Aguilar directs the Public Affairs and Educational Outreach Department at the Harvard-Smithsonian Center for Astrophysics. A naturalist, astronomer, world lecturer and astronomical artist, his work reflects his passion for bringing the wonders of science to audiences.  David is an award winning author and illustrator of seven National Geographic books including “PLANETS, STARS, AND GALAXIES: A Visual Encyclopedia of Our Universe, “11 PLANETS”, “SUPER STARS”, “13 PLANETS”, “ SPACE ENCYCLOPEDIA”, the “Kid’s BIG BOOK of Space”, and “ALIEN WORLDS”.  David is the past director of the Fiske Planetarium and Science Center at the University of Colorado in Boulder, director of Marketing Communications at Ball Aerospace, marketing director for the PBS Emmy-winning NOVA series, “Evolution”, and writer/illustrator/narrator of “The UNIVERSE” TV program, “Alien Faces”. He is scholar and enrichment lecturer for Smithsonian Journeys and Harvard World Tours. In 2010, asteroid 1990DA was named after him in honor of his educational outreach efforts.
